Reputation refers to the overall perception or opinion that others have of a person, organization, or entity, often based on past actions, achievements, and behaviors. It plays a significant role in social, professional, and commercial contexts, influencing interactions and relationships, as well as opportunities for advancement or collaboration.
Reputation meaning with examples
- After years of hard work and integrity, James built a reputation as a trustworthy leader, gaining the respect and admiration of his colleagues. This reputation not only opened doors for him but also inspired his team to strive for excellence, fostering a culture of accountability and dedication within the organization.
- The scandal damaged the company's reputation, causing a significant decline in sales and customer trust. To repair this, they launched a public relations campaign aimed at restoring their image, focusing on transparency and community engagement, highlighting their commitment to ethical practices and sustainable business operations.
- In the competitive world of academia, a scholar's reputation can determine their career trajectory. Publishing impactful research and collaborating with esteemed colleagues can enhance one's reputation, making it easier to secure funding and attract top students, while a tarnished reputation can lead to missed opportunities.
- A celebrity's reputation is carefully managed by publicists and agents, as any misstep can lead to negative media coverage and public backlash. Maintaining a positive public image is crucial for their career longevity, influencing endorsement deals, fan loyalty, and overall marketability in the entertainment industry.
- In sports, an athlete's reputation is vital; a reputation for fair play and sportsmanship can enhance an athlete's legacy, attracting sponsorships and fan support. Conversely, controversies or poor conduct can lead to a tarnished reputation that impacts their ability to secure contracts and endorsements.
